In A Lonely Place (1950)
Humphrey Bogart, in a revelatory, vulnerable performance, plays a screenwriter who becomes the prime suspect in a brutal Tinseltown murder. Step forward a neighbour (Gloria Grahame), with her own troubled past, as his unlikely alibi. A turbulent mix of suspenseful noir and devastating melodrama, fuelled by powerhouse performances, 'In a Lonely Place' this is one of the greatest films of the 1950s, and a benchmark in the career of the classic Hollywood auteur Nicholas Ray.
